How Does a CT Scan Of The Chest Work?

A CT scan uses X-ray technology combined with computer processing to create detailed images. During the procedure, the patient lies on a table that slides into a large, doughnut-shaped machine called a CT scanner. As the machine rotates around the patient, it takes multiple X-ray images from various angles. These images are then reconstructed by a computer to produce cross-sectional views of the chest.

The entire process typically takes about 10 to 30 minutes. Patients may be asked to hold their breath briefly while images are being captured to minimize motion blur. In some cases, a contrast dye may be injected into a vein before the scan to enhance visibility of certain structures.

Preparation for a CT Scan Of The Chest

Preparing for a CT scan is generally straightforward but may vary depending on individual circumstances and whether contrast material will be used. Here are some common preparation steps:

    • Inform Your Doctor: Discuss any allergies, especially to iodine or contrast materials.
    • Avoid Eating: If contrast dye is used, you may be asked not to eat or drink for several hours prior.
    • Wear Comfortable Clothing: Loose-fitting clothes without metal fastenings are recommended.
    • Remove Accessories: Jewelry and other metallic items should be removed before the scan.

It’s essential to follow any specific instructions provided by your healthcare provider to ensure accurate results.

What Conditions Can Be Diagnosed with a CT Scan Of The Chest?

A CT scan of the chest can help diagnose various medical conditions. Below is a table summarizing some common conditions that can be identified through this imaging technique:

Condition Description
Lung Cancer CT scans can detect tumors in their early stages.
Pneumonia This imaging helps identify areas of infection in lung tissues.
Pulmonary Embolism CT pulmonary angiography visualizes blood clots in pulmonary arteries.
Interstitial Lung Disease CT scans reveal patterns of lung scarring or inflammation.
Aortic Aneurysm This imaging technique helps assess dilation or rupture in the aorta.

These conditions represent just a fraction of what can be diagnosed via this imaging method. Each diagnosis can lead to tailored treatment strategies that improve patient care.

The Risks Associated with a CT Scan Of The Chest

While generally safe, there are some risks associated with undergoing a CT scan of the chest that patients should consider:

    • Radiation Exposure: Although minimal compared to other procedures, there is still exposure to ionizing radiation.
    • Allergic Reactions: Some patients may experience allergic reactions to contrast materials used during scans.
    • Pregnancy Concerns: Pregnant women should discuss potential risks with their physician due to radiation exposure considerations.

It’s crucial for patients to weigh these risks against the potential benefits when considering whether to undergo this diagnostic procedure.

The Role of Contrast Material in CT Scans

In many cases, contrast material is administered during a CT scan of the chest. This substance enhances image quality by highlighting specific areas within the body.

Contrast material typically contains iodine and can be injected intravenously or taken orally before scanning. It helps delineate blood vessels and highlights abnormalities more clearly than non-contrast scans.

Patients might feel warmth or flushing when contrast material enters their bloodstream; however, these sensations usually subside quickly. It’s important for individuals with known allergies or kidney issues to inform their healthcare provider beforehand.

The Interpretation of Results from a CT Scan Of The Chest

Once completed, radiologists analyze the images produced by the CT scan. They look for abnormalities such as masses, fluid accumulation, or structural changes within organs.

Results are typically communicated back to the referring physician within 24 hours after completion. Depending on findings, further tests or treatments may be recommended based on what was observed during imaging.

Patients should have follow-up discussions with their healthcare providers regarding results and any subsequent steps needed based on those findings.

The Cost Considerations for a CT Scan Of The Chest

Cost is often an essential factor when considering medical procedures like a CT scan of the chest. Prices can vary widely based on location, facility type (hospital vs outpatient center), and whether insurance covers part or all costs.

On average, patients might expect costs ranging from $300 to $3,000 without insurance coverage; however, many insurance plans do cover diagnostic imaging when deemed medically necessary.

It’s advisable for patients to verify coverage details beforehand and inquire about payment options if they lack insurance.
